Position Summary

The IT Help Desk Intern will provide first-level technical support to

end users by assisting with hardware, software, and basic

network-related issues. This position offers hands-on experience in an

enterprise IT environment while developing troubleshooting, customer

service, and technical support skills.

The intern will work closely with the IT team to support employees

through the help desk ticketing system, perform desktop and laptop

deployments, troubleshoot Microsoft Office applications, and assist with

daily IT oper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Respond to and resolve Level 1 help desk tickets in a timely and

professional manner.

  • Provide technical support via phone, email, remote assistance, and

in-person support.

  • Diagnose and troubleshoot desktop and laptop hardware issues.
  • Configure, image, deploy, and set up new desktop and laptop

computers.

  • Install and configure Windows operating systems and standard

business applications.

  • Troubleshoot Microsoft Office and Microsoft 365 application issues.
  • Assist users with password resets, account access, printer

connectivity, and peripheral devices.

  • Replace or upgrade computer components such as memory, hard

drives/SSDs, docking stations, monitors, keyboards, and mice.

  • Perform software installations, updates, and system patches.
  • Document support activities and resolutions within the IT ticketing

system.

  • Escalate complex technical issues to senior IT staff when

appropriate.

  • Maintain inventory of IT assets including laptops, desktops,

monitors, and accessories.

  • Assist with workstation moves, equipment deployments, and office

setup projects.

  • Support basic network connectivity troubleshooting including wired

and wireless connections.

  • Follow company IT security policies and best practices.
  • Participate in IT projects and other duties as assigned.
